Some patients grind their teeth when they feel stressed or even while asleep. While teeth grinding in Aurora, also known as bruxism, is common in both adults and children, it can lead to serious complications if left untreated. Frequent grinding severely damages your teeth and jaw and can also contribute to temporomandibular joint disorder (TMD). This disorder is characterized by abnormal clenching and grinding of the teeth either during waking hours (awake bruxism) or during sleep (sleep bruxism).
